Bill Sponsors: NY A03705 | 2011-2012 | General Assembly

Bill Title: Provides that antitrust laws shall not apply to any joint agreement entered into, in consultation with and approved by the state racing and wagering board, by or among non-profit associations, thoroughbred racing associations or corporations, harness racing associations or corporations, quarter horse racing associations or corporations and regional off-track betting corporations to coordinate the dates and times under which they will conduct programs of racing and offer pari-mutuel wagering; also provides that such laws shall not apply to agreements entered into to sell, transfer, assign or purchase the rights to broadcast, simulcast, electronically transmit or offer pari-mutuel wagering on horse races.

Spectrum: Slight Partisan Bill (Democrat 2-1)

Status: (Vetoed) 2011-08-03 - tabled [A03705 Detail]
